I can't comment on Commonwealth Bank as we haven't used them. We're using HSBC at the moment and haven't had any serious problems. The only drawbacks to HSBC are that they don't have many branches so if you're not happy banking over the phone or internet they're probably not for you (Commonwealth Bank seem to have branches everywhere) and there are some places that won't accept their EFTPOS card.

An online account with Citibank, Ing etc has to be used in conjunction with an account at a 'bricks and mortar' bank such as the Commonwealth. You have your pay etc paid into the latter account and can transfer backwards and forwards to the former. FWIW I've dealt with the Commonwealth for many years and 'touch wood' haven't had any problems. As has been said HSBC could be better for all I know but they don't have many branches which is an important consideration.
